locked
PipelineStoppedException RRS feed

  • Question

  • Hi all

    I wrote a Mp to monitor a ETERNUS Storage system.

    In my MP,i can monitor all the component(CM, CA, Disk,Volume and so on) of the storage systems.

    I used powershell to get information from storage and display it on scom.

    when there are two storage systems,it worked fine.

    but when there are 6 storage systems to be monitored,error happened.

    [Information]  2015/12/16 19:39:40  The execution of FTRP RG Information costs    12 sec
    [Information]  2015/12/16 19:39:40  The execution of FTRP LUN Performance costs   16 sec
    [Information]  2015/12/16 19:39:41  The execution of TPP RG Information costs     19 sec
    [Information]  2015/12/16 19:39:42  The execution of FTRP Disk Information costs  15 sec
    [Information]  2015/12/16 19:39:42  The execution of RG LUN Performance costs     24 sec
    [Information]  2015/12/16 19:39:43  The execution of TPP LUN Information costs    20 sec
    [Error]        2015/12/16 19:39:43  Can't get TPP Disk Performacne             
    [Error]        2015/12/16 19:39:43  Error MessageSystem.Management.Automation.PipelineStoppedException: Pipeline has stopped
        System.Management.Automation.MshCommandRuntime.WriteObject(Object sendToPipeline)
        System.Management.Automation.Cmdlet.WriteObject(Object sendToPipeline)
        GetTPPDiskPerformList.GetTPPDiskPerformList.ProcessRecord()
    [Information]  2015/12/16 19:39:43  The execution of TPP Disk Performance costs   46 sec

    here is my question, why do de pipeline be stopped?

    Does SCOM agent has any limit on the powershell be executed on the same time?

    Friday, December 18, 2015 3:33 AM